Senior Philanthropy Manager

  • Field: Charities
  • Deadline: 2026-03-07 04:03
  • City of London, London
The Senior Philanthropy Manager will be responsible for leading and growing the philanthropy programme, focusing on cultivating relationships with major donors to support the organisation's vision. This role requires strategic thinking and a results-driven approach to secure funding in the not-for-profit sector.

Client Details

This opportunity is with a respected organisation in the not-for-profit sector, committed to making a positive impact in society. Operating as part of a medium-sized team, the organisation is recognised for its dedication to achieving meaningful change.

Description

Develop and implement a comprehensive strategy for major donor fundraising.
Build and maintain strong relationships with high-net-worth individuals and key stakeholders.
Prepare compelling proposals, presentations, and reports for donors.
Identify and research new potential donors to expand the funding base.
Collaborate with internal teams to align fundraising efforts with organisational goals.
Monitor and report on fundraising performance to ensure targets are met.
Organise and attend donor events to strengthen relationships.
Ensure compliance with fundraising regulations and best practices.Profile

A successful Senior Philanthropy Manager should have:

A proven track record in major donor fundraising or a related area.
Experience working in the not-for-profit sector.
Strong communication and relationship-building skills.
Ability to develop and execute effective fundraising strategies.
Proficiency in preparing persuasive proposals and presentations.
Knowledge of fundraising regulations and compliance.Job Offer
